Roasted Curried Red Pepper Sauce
Bacon wrapped stuffed chicken with homemade roasted red pepper sauce, served along side crispy baked potatoes, and sauteed baby beans. Ingredients
Quantities are shown as originally provided.
- 1 red pepper
- ½ cup chicken broth
- 1 tsp curry powder
- 1 tsp carob powder
- Salt and pepper
- ¼ yellow onion
- 2 cloves garlic (smashed)
- 1 tsp olive oil
Instructions
- 1
Make sauce by placing red pepper directly over the burner and char skin all over.
- 2
Place the charred pepper in a food safe zip lock, seal, and allow to cool.
- 3
When cooled, peel off charred skin, do not wash it! You will be tempted, just wipe it off with a paper towel if needed. The skin should come off quite easily.
- 4
Remove the core and seed, and discard it.
- 5
Chop pepper into smaller pieces.
- 6
In a saucepan over medium high heat and olive oil, saute onion and smashed garlic until onion is soft and translucent.
- 7
Add roasted pepper and cook for a minute.
- 8
Pour in stock, curry powder, salt and pepper.
- 9
Bring to boil, and allow to simmer on low heat for 5 minutes.
- 10
Then blend with immersion blender or transfer to blender to blend until smooth.
